The Effect of Ransomware

In this heightened exposure environment, ransomware attacks have become especially rampant. Fitch’s Health of the Cyber Insurance Market report notes the direct loss ratio rose to 47 percent in 2019 from the 34 percent level of 2018, with much of this due to ransomware.

The proliferation of ransomware is creating reimagined loss patterns for the sector and blurring the lines between attritional and catastrophic cyber loss. Furthermore, the criminal actors behind this continue to shift behaviors, becoming even more advanced and relentless. According to Crowdstrike, (1) “The most prominent eCrime trend observed so far in 2020 is big game hunting (BGH) actors stealing and leaking victim data in order to force ransom payments and, in some cases, demand two ransoms. Data extortion is not a new tactic for criminal adversaries; however, when BGH operations don’t result in payment, victims now face a double-headed threat of ensuring their data does not make it into the hands of others.”

Ransomware has progressively become a loss trend across the cyber industry, with pricing strategies being recalibrated to account for this growing risk. Potential New Attack Vectors and Technology Impacts

Increasing reliance on technology makes businesses more vulnerable to risks inside and outside the organization. The resulting inter-connectivity creates a dependency maze across businesses and their business partners. For the (re)insurance industry, this supply chain web fuels severity concerns and the potential for systemic events.

All the while, threats to businesses are becoming more advanced and difficult to detect. Emerging trends include:

  • The proliferation of big data and cloud computing – confidentiality, integrity and availability of data are critical to organizational survival, whether they be nation state secrets, industrial intellectual property (IP) or personal sensitive data
  • Cyber-attacks on mobile devices are increasing and are likely to become a primary phishing vector for credential attacks in 2020. As a result, dual-factor authentication will move to multi-factor authentication
  • The continued use of social engineering through phishing and smishing
  • An increase in the proliferation of malware and ransomware
  • The increasing use of artificial intelligence
  • Voice-based cybercrime, which is growing along with the explosion of voice-directed digital assistants
  • Global adoption of 5G infrastructure technology
  • Newer technologies like deep fake video and audio technology.

The Impact of COVID-19 on Business Models

COVID-19 has only accelerated the trajectory of the cyber exposure landscape. As companies adapted to increased working from home circumstances, changing demand for their products and interrupted supply chains, they adapted their business models and utilized new technologies. This new normal has resulted in increased potential for cyber risk events, and we have observed the following cyber risk amplifiers:

  • Alternate modes of working*
  • Different technology utilization
  • Less familiar modes of data movement and exchange
  • Rebalancing of supply chain dynamics and third party reliance
  • Key personnel risk
  • Management and staff distraction
  • Facility access and collaboration constraints
  • Ability to deal with a ‘double whammy’ crisis of COVID-19 and cyber attack
  • Rogue actor motivation

*Between February 4, 2020 and April 7, 2020 there was an estimated 70 percent increase in remote working (source: Carbon Black)

While COVID-19 hasn’t introduced new exposure to the cyber insurance industry, these amplifiers have expanded the cyber attack surface and are prompting organizations to manage risk differently. How the Market Continues to Address Silent Cyber

The sector’s understanding of silent cyber has meaningfully developed in recent years following the NotPetya and WannaCry attacks, which highlighted the potentially catastrophic impact of silent cyber within non-cyber lines of business. This underlying exposure’s potential for aggregated loss is currently one of the major issues being considered by the (re)insurance industry.

The UK Prudential Regulatory Authority (PRA) stated on January 30, 2019: “Firms reported challenging market conditions, broker pressure, and lack of historical data, models and expertise as the main impediments for the prudential management of cyber underwriting risk. We appreciate these challenges but do not believe they are insurmountable.” In addition, in January 2019 the PRA issued a “Dear CEO” letter indicating that all (re)insurers should develop Silent Cyber Action Plans to evaluate, model and quantify risks.

The Lloyd’s Market Bulletin that became effective in January 2020 requires all syndicates to provide clarity on the cyber exposure in all their policies, giving clients contract certainty. This approach, which will be phased in over the course of 2020 and 2021, is particularly focused on driving the eradication of silent cyber from traditional lines of insurance by encouraging insurers to identify the exposure and either clearly exclude or affirmatively include it.

Globally, we have seen regulators issue similar statements on managing silent cyber risks, including the European Insurance and Occupational Pensions Authority and in the United States, the National Association of Insurance Commissioners, issuing their guidelines to help firms manage this risk.

Insurers and reinsurers have now developed underwriting strategies, portfolio roadmaps and clarifying language to address this growing concern. Though formal timeframes have not been established in the United States, it is clear that the changing market conditions of 2020 have created an opportune time for eradication efforts to accelerate around silent cyber.

This industry-wide initiative is a massive undertaking for risk bearers and requires a multi-stakeholder approach with cyber strategies being revisited across all lines of business as new events transpire, incident data becomes more robust and legal precedent develops.
